Garswood Train Station is equipped with facilities designed to make your travel seamless. Among the essentials, the station features a ticket office with extensive opening hours from 06:00 to 23:45 on weekdays and 08:00 to 23:35 on Sundays, allowing passengers ample time to plan their travel. Additionally, ticket machines are available for those who prefer to collect tickets purchased online.
The station is accessible, with step-free access provided to notable areas, although it's worth noting that there is limited accessibility between platforms. A convenient footbridge with handrails connects platforms, ensuring that most travelers feel accommodated.
Garswood station is well-linked to different transportation modes. While traditional taxi services are easily accessible, the station also provides a href="Cab4you" service for those requiring an easy transition between station and their final destination. Bus services operate in the vicinity, with convenient stops adjacent to the station entrance.
For those who prefer cycling, the station provides bicycle storage options with CCTV protection for peace of mind.

Simplistic yet practical, Saltburn Station features essential amenities for a seamless travel experience. While it doesn't boast a ticket office, ticket machines are conveniently placed for passenger use to collect tickets, including those bought online. These machines are easily accessible, especially for those requiring step-free access. Moreover, the station supports the use of smartcards, making it more convenient for frequent travelers, although it lacks smartcard validators.
Accessibility is a priority at Saltburn, categorized as a 'Category A' station, implying that step-free access is available throughout. The absence of ticket barriers and gates further ensures an unimpeded travel experience. However, amenities like waiting rooms, seating areas, and toilet facilities for general or accessible use are notably absent. Passengers are encouraged to plan accordingly.
Saltburn offers several travel connections beyond the train station. The nearby cab services serve those needing a personal ride while the adjacent bus stop ensures public transport options are also covered. Rail replacement services operate conveniently from Dundas West Street alongside the platform, ensuring uninterrupted travel during service disruptions.
